logo

Output 33eaa59b8ec131ebd0374b2f7aa9ec4e0a0f28e6b0711fc7b8855329f9d219d9: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e444587cb8101f682e3fe7105d348e8c46edd11 OP_EQUAL
address
3QsTLrzr238wBeabWb5eRnU324L8jZpEqR
transaction
33eaa59b8ec131ebd0374b2f7aa9ec4e0a0f28e6b0711fc7b8855329f9d219d9